Core Features and Functions
MDF, or Medium Density Fiberboard, is created by breaking down hardwood or softwood residuals into wood fibers, which are then combined with wax and a resin binder under heat and pressure. The resulting boards exhibit a uniform density, making them ideal for applications where smooth surfaces are essential, such as cabinetry, furniture, and decorative moldings. With various thicknesses ranging from 1/4 inch to 1 inch and densities typically between 30-50 lbs/ft³, MDF board products offer superior machinability, allowing for intricate designs and finishes.
Furthermore, MDF boards are often available with different surface treatments, including veneered, laminated, or even raw for further custom woodworking. This versatility allows designers to leverage MDF for various applications without sacrificing aesthetic appeal. Importantly, MDF board products can be manufactured with low emission standards, making them compliant with stringent indoor air quality regulations.
Advantages and Application Scenarios
The benefits of integrating MDF board products into design projects are multifaceted. One of the most significant advantages is their affordability without compromising quality. They provide a cost-effective alternative to traditional hardwood, making them particularly attractive to designers and contractors working on budget-sensitive projects.
